Munich-based Dornier 328 maintenance specialist, 328 Support Service, has established a sister design organisation, which gained EASA Part 21J approval last month.

Named 328 Design, the company's objective is to bring engineering services "back in-house for a true one-stop shop", said Jörg Gorkenant, head of design.

Its team will work together with equipment engineering specialist Avionics Mobile Design Services, which became part of the group in 2009.

The 328 Support Service and 328 Design operations are located at Oberpfaffenhofen airfield outside Munich.

Around 200 turboprop- and turbofan-equipped 328 aircraft are in service today.
